The St. Clare's Hospital Family Health Center is located in the
adjoining Cushing Center. It features 26 examination rooms, special
procedure rooms, conference and precepting areas, faculty offices,
laboratory, resident offices, and waiting, reception and business areas.
The center’s staff includes physician assistants, nurse practitioner,
nurses, nursing technicians, medical secretaries and clerical personnel.
The FHC registers more than 30,000 patient visits annually. Home visits
by the residents are arranged and supervised by faculty. We also have
privileges to manage nursing home patients during their hospital stay.
Patient records are maintained in compliance with HIPAA regulations and
are moving towards an EMR system in compliance with the recommendations
of ACGME.
Behavioral Science group meetings are held regularly with a faculty
psychologist focusing on professional and personal situations
encountered by the residents, their families and significant others.
A Practice Management consultant is available through the center to
acquaint residents with financial, staffing and business related
information and to assist in the transition to private practice after
graduation.
The center functions as a private group practice with the advantage of
having readily available consultants as scheduled preceptors.
Subspecialty consultants provide resident education and on-site
consultation. Consultants are scheduled on a regular basis from the
following disciplines:

The nursing staff has amassed extensive experience in such areas as
acute care, emergency room, OB/Gyn, Surgery, Geriatrics, substance
abuse, Oncology, and more. Most are seasoned veterans of the nursing
profession and help create an environment conducive to resident
training.
Nursing staff take an active role in specialty clinics including OB/Gyn,
ID, minor surgery and diabetes education. Additional diabetes support is
available through the hospital’s Diabetes Management Program.
